Question 1100122: A credit card company randomly generates temporary 4-digit pass codes for cardholders. What is the probablity that a pass code will consist of different even digits?
A) 25/144 B) 1/12 C) 1/80 D)3/250

Answer by jorel1380(3719)   (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
5 digits, 4 at a time=5x4x3x2=120
120/10000=.012=3/250
